The Effect of Troxerutin Consumption on the Symptoms of Morphine Withdrawal Syndrome in Male Mice

Abstract :Introduction: Chronic morphine use is associated with increased oxidative stress and inflammatory factors. Troxerutin is a natural bioflavonoid and has antioxidant and anti-inflammatory effects that could relieve morphine withdrawal syndrome. Aim: The effects of troxerutin on morphine dependence in mice Method: Troxerutin was prepared in three different doses insert ignore into journalissuearticles values(50, 100, and 200 mg/kg); via a normal saline solution. After examining the composition of troxerutin, the experiment was performed in five groups of 8 mice. One group received eight days of increasing doses insert ignore into journalissuearticles values(10, 20, 30, 40, 50, and 60 mg/kg); of morphine SC insert ignore into journalissuearticles values(subcutaneously); with normal saline insert ignore into journalissuearticles values(10 ml/kg); IP insert ignore into journalissuearticles values(Intraperitoneal);, and one group received only normal saline and the other three groups received three different doses of troxerutin solved in normal saline as the carrier of troxerutin along with morphine. On the ninth day, withdrawal symptoms were recorded after naloxone injection and blood samples were examined for antioxidant factors. Results: The total withdrawal score in the 50 mg/kg dose of the troxerutin group with morphine was significantly lower than the morphine-saline group insert ignore into journalissuearticles values(p 0.05);. Conclusion: Troxerutin reduces the symptoms of morphine withdrawal syndrome in a dose-dependent manner. The results of antioxidant tests declared that troxerutin would increase the level of TAC insert ignore into journalissuearticles values(Total Antioxidant Capacity); and decrease the level of MDA insert ignore into journalissuearticles values(Malondialdehyde); in the serum of mice possibly due to its antioxidant properties.
Keywords : morphine, troxerutin, withdrawal syndrome, dependence, MDA, TAC, mice
